Flying Scientists Help Nearly Extinct Birds Learn to Migrate Again

  • Waldrappteam guides 36 hand-raised northern bald ibises on a 1,740-mile migration from Austria to Spain using an ultralight aircraft.
  • The journey, spanning about 1,740 miles, is expected to take up to 50 days with midair coordination from foster parents Helena Wehner and Barbara Steininger.
  • The project follows the birds’ migratory route and addresses climate-change-driven shifts in timing and range.
  • The team adapts routes to avoid harsher Alpine weather, moving the project forward despite challenges.
  • Bill Lishman’s 'Father Goose' work inspired the method of teaching ibises to migrate via human-guided flight.
  • The ibises' status has shifted from critically endangered to endangered thanks to conservation efforts.
  • The 2024 migration marks the 17th year of Waldrappteam’s intensive conservation flights.
  • Researchers and birds travel in stages, sometimes with two team members aboard the ultralight at a time.
  • On August 28, 2024, the team reported roughly 64 miles covered over France as part of the route.
